  • The application of wavelet-transformation to alarming in loose parts monitoring system(LPMS) was studied. On the base of analyzing the main factor to the erroralarming in LPMS,the alarming theory in view of wavelet's RMS was established by choosing minor scale of relative noise as alarming datum point,and the base noise which affect alarm was checked effectively.Moreover RMS threshold and time width RMS threshold wavelet alarming algorithm were adopted,all make the alarm more dependable.
